Carote Recipe

Inspired by Tavernetta
Time30m
Serves4

Mokum Carrot, Buffalo Ricotta, Peperoni, Pistachio

Method

Preparation Steps

1

Prepare the Carrots

Peel and chop Mokum carrots into small, even pieces. Steam or boil them for about 5-7 minutes until tender but still crisp. Drain and let cool.

2

Make the Dressing

In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, honey, salt, and black pepper. Adjust seasoning to taste.

3

Combine Ingredients

In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ooled Mokum carrots, Buffalo ricotta, roasted red peppers, and chopped pistachios. Pour the dressing over the mixture and gently toss to combine.

4

Garnish and Serve

Transfer the salad to a serving platter and sprinkle with fresh basil. Serve immediately or chill for 30 minutes for flavors to meld.
